Tales of an Empty Cabin is a collection of essays and short stories, written by the Canadian author Grey Owl (18881938). It was published in 1936 in Great Britain by Lovat Dickson & Thompson Limited and in Canada by Macmillan of Canada.[1]:297 Publications by other publishing houses, such as Dodd, Mead & Co. in the United States, followed.
